1) \( \frac{a^{2}-a b+a-b}{a^{2}+2 a+1} \cdot \frac{3}{6 a^{2}-6 a b}= \)

Calculate or simplify the expression \( (a^2-a*b+a-b)/(a^2+2*a+1) * (3/(6*a^2-6*a*b)) \).
Simplify the expression by following steps:
- step0: Solution:
\(\frac{\left(a^{2}-ab+a-b\right)}{\left(a^{2}+2a+1\right)}\times \left(\frac{3}{\left(6a^{2}-6ab\right)}\right)\)
- step1: Remove the parentheses:
\(\frac{a^{2}-ab+a-b}{a^{2}+2a+1}\times \left(\frac{3}{6a^{2}-6ab}\right)\)
- step2: Divide the terms:
\(\frac{a^{2}-ab+a-b}{a^{2}+2a+1}\times \frac{1}{2a^{2}-2ab}\)
- step3: Divide the terms:
\(\frac{a-b}{a+1}\times \frac{1}{2a^{2}-2ab}\)
- step4: Rewrite the expression:
\(\frac{a-b}{a+1}\times \frac{1}{2a\left(a-b\right)}\)
- step5: Reduce the fraction:
\(\frac{1}{a+1}\times \frac{1}{2a}\)
- step6: Multiply the terms:
\(\frac{1}{\left(a+1\right)\times 2a}\)
- step7: Multiply the terms:
\(\frac{1}{2a\left(a+1\right)}\)
- step8: Multiply the terms:
\(\frac{1}{2a^{2}+2a}\)
La expresión simplificada es \( \frac{1}{2a^{2}+2a} \).
